Which Singaporean tourist treasures should Google Street View Trike visit? Vote now.

One month ago, Google and the Singapore Tourism Board embarked on a quest to map out a path of the Google Street View trike together with the Singaporean public. Over a thousand suggestions later, Google received an extensive list, ranging from the spooky to the adventurous. After thoroughly reviewing all the options, 24 locations have been shortlisted according to four categories: The City & Quays, Cultural Areas, Natural Wonders, and Hidden Gems.

You have until November 19 2009 to cast your vote and decide the top location in each of the four categories the Google Trike will visit.
The Google trike is a mechanical masterpiece comprising three bicycle wheels, a mounted Street View camera and a specially decorated box containing image-collecting gadgetry. It comes complete with a very athletic cyclist in customised Google apparel.
Images collected by the trike will be processed and carefully stitched together, a technological process that can take several months. They will be made available at a later date in Street View on Google Maps. Watch our video of the Google trike by clicking the play button above.
